So, 'My Fat Arse and I' is quite the quirky gem from Yelyzaveta Pysmak. It dives into the absurdity of body image through this animated lens. The pacing is a bit erratic, but in a way that mirrors the protagonist's chaotic journey with food and self-acceptance. The visuals are strikingly vivid, giving life to her exaggerated transformations. Honestly, the girl’s zombie-like fridge raids are hilarious yet relatable. The themes of hunger and self-perception are explored with a blend of humor and depth. It’s not your typical animation; it has this rawness that feels both personal and universal. Definitely a unique take on what we do when we’re faced with our insecurities.
